Kelly Donati, Winner of the Le Cordon Bleu 2013 Scholarship for the Hautes Etudes du Goût program

Kelly Donati is the winner of the partial scholarship offered by Le Cordon Bleu International for one of its most prestigious programs: Hautes Etudes du Goût.

Celebrating Queen Elizabeth II’s Coronation Anniversary

As Queen Elizabeth II celebrates the 60th anniversary of her coronation on Sunday 2nd June, Le Cordon Bleu looks back on the event and the contribution of our former London principal Rosemary Hume.

Juan Arbelaez

In 2007, Juan decided to follow his childhood dream and passion for Cuisine and enrolled at Le Cordon Bleu Paris. He graduated in 2008 with a Grand Diplôme having completed the Cuisine and then the Pastry diploma with flying colors.
